The Brompton Pentaclip - it's used for connecting the Brompton saddle to the Brompton seatpost
It has a clutch mechanism inside - plated which connect together to allow a large range of adjustment of the saddle angle etc
We made this video as sometimes it falls apart when trying to remove from a saddle - so this will help with re-assembly - this video providing instructions
It also shows how to remove / install from the seatpost and the saddle

    One continuity error in the demo is at 5.07 the demo shows pentaclip fitted in the upper position but when the saddle is turned at 5.18 the pentaclip has already been modified to the lower position. Unfortunately the video does not show fitting the pentaclip to the rails in the lower position which is the more difficult of the two positions. Had lots of difficulty fitting it. Eventually by turning the logo portion through 90 degrees it allowed the rails to flex more and snap it all in.

    Yes, I noticed the same thing - you do notice it when you've tried it this way and realise it is so much more difficult. Also, with some saddles, if you fit the Pentaclip above the rails ("inside"), you can't reach the bolt to tighten it, because the saddle side covers it (not all saddles, but many).

    Done without completely disassembling the pentaclip: saddle on the ground placed sideways, removed the bolt from above holding the central parts with your fingers, turned the two ends, put the bolt back.
